Review Detail
1998 Clover Hill Vintage Brut
Wine Rating
91
Produced by Taltarni, Clover Hill has been a forebear for sparkling in Tasmania, creating a niche in the upper echelon of producers in the region.
The wine has aged gracefully, tasted just short of its 18th birthday it’s a developed yellow in colour and maintained a fine bead with a leesy / blue cheese nose backed by stewed stone fruits.
The palate has developed richness but just enough acidity to keep things balanced, accentuated peaches and cream are stained by a touch of citrus to finish.
